How to propagate hydrangea

Cutting time

The best time for hydrangea cuttings is from May to June, when the temperature is suitable, the light is moderate, everything is just right!

All materials must be prepared before cutting. Choose a flower pot according to the number of cuttings you want. Usually one flower pot has 2 to 3 leaves. You can also prepare a larger flower pot and transplant the cuttings after they survive. Place tiles on the bottom of the prepared flowerpot, fill it with soil and water it thoroughly, and leave it for two days before use.

For seedlings to be grafted, choose strong new shoots from this year, and cut off the lower leaves when they are about 10 to 15 cm long. If conditions permit, you can use carbendazim to disinfect the plants so that they are less likely to get sick.

Cutting method

Use a small wooden stick to poke holes in the soil surface. The main purpose is to loosen the soil so that the soil will not be too hard when cuttings are planted. Insert the branches 3 to 5 cm into the soil and press the surrounding soil firmly.

After cuttings, place the pot in a cool place. Try not to water it too much after cuttings to keep the soil moist. It will take 15 to 20 days for the seeds to take root and survive. Apply fertilizer and water once a month to strengthen the seedlings. They can be transplanted in 2 months.

When the new seedlings grow to a certain height, they should be topped and pinched in time to shorten the tops of the branches to promote the growth of flower buds, so that the plants will have lush branches and abundant flowers.
